An early warning system for automobiles
Quality information about cars currently relies on ‘lagging’ indicators, such as warranty costs, calls to customer service numbers and dealer service records. The trouble is that this information is only available after something has happened. IBM is working on a solution that will combine data from multiple sources and provide manufacturers with an Early Warning System to identify potential problems before they become major liabilities.

Cancelable Biometrics
The use of biometrics, which uses physiological or behavioral characteristics to verify identities for security and privacy purposes, is growing. But determined identity thieves have already learned how to copy credentials from large databases. IBM Researchers are developing methods to help companies stay one step ahead, with a novel technique that distorts biometric data.

Transactional multi-site Grids
Grid computing is already successfully being used for scientific applications that require large amounts of processing power as well as computationally intensive financial applications, such as portfolio optimization and risk analysis. Applying that processing power to everyday transactions and core business processes is the next step. Web-enabled Integrated Aftermarket Services
Aftermarket parts management involves a number of critical processes that often span multiple organizations and geographies in order to deliver a part to a customer on time. Seeing an opportunity to bring significant value to the challenge of aftermarket parts management, several IBM divisions are collaborating to develop an integrated aftermarket parts solution.
